Add GET /api/audio-stream/{slug}/{n}?voice= that streams MP3 audio to the
client as TTS generates it, while simultaneously uploading to MinIO. On
subsequent requests the endpoint redirects to the presigned MinIO URL,
skipping generation entirely.
- PocketTTS: StreamAudioMP3 pipes live WAV response body through ffmpeg
(streaming transcode — no full-buffer wait)
- Kokoro: StreamAudioMP3 uses stream:true mode, returning MP3 frames
directly without the two-step download-link flow
- AudioStore: PutAudioStream added for multipart MinIO upload from reader
- WriteTimeout bumped 60s → 15min to accommodate full-chapter streams
- X-Accel-Buffering: no header disables Caddy/nginx response buffering
